63 - Winter 2026 From the first positive pregnancy test to the first time you hold your baby, parenthood invites you into unfamiliar territory. Natural parenting encourages you to slow down and tune in. To trust your body during pregnancy and birth. To respond to your baby with confidence and connection. To recognise that while expert guidance can be valuable, no one knows your child quite like you do. As our children grow, so do we. In this issue, you’ll find inspiration, practical guidance, heartfelt stories and trusted resources covering pregnancy, birth, breastfeeding, health, babywearing and more. Breastfeeding Counsellor Danielle Facey shares her personal journey of preparing to breastfeed her second baby. She discusses colostrum harvesting, skin to skin, lactation support, bed-sharing and her plans to go in “informed, resourced and a great deal kinder to myself than I was before”. Rosie Humberstone asks the question, “Can we really have an undisturbed birth in the maternity system today?” and delves into the practice of non-focused awareness. She talks about how regardless of where you end up labouring, there will be distractions and disturbances, and that it is what you do and how you respond that you do have some control over. Genevieve Simperingham shares valuable advice on supporting and protecting children through parental separation, ensuring they feel “seen, heard and held throughout the process”. She recommends ways to help your children through transitions and some tools to support emotional security.
